Buzynski siblings: Going the distance

Brooke and Tim Buzynski have more in common these days than a place to rest their heads…and their legs. In fact, the senior and sophomore siblings spend most of their waking hours together too: training, running and cheering each other on at meets and practice for Central’s cross country team. Tim, with a time of 17:15 holds the record for the fastest male runner on the team and credits his sister and family for the inspiration he needs to channel that force on the courses. “She’s my biggest fan. We definitely give each other support, “ he said of Brooke, who says she hopes to continue her running next year at college. Brooke’s 3.1 mile (5k) time is 22:40. She said that that since she and her brother have committed to running, their father has taken up the sport as well. Even their younger sister, an eighth grader, competes on the middle school cross country team. Both say Coach Randy Mumford has been their driving force through his team and personal discipline, his wisdom and his years of experience. “He trains us to be the best we can be,” said Brooke. “He has this motto he says to us all the time: Practice the run. Become the run. Forget about the run.”
